Rare notamermaid Posted January 14, 2017 #3 Share Posted January 14, 2017 Hello hostjazzbeau, quite right about the geography, Cologne being the only on the river Rhine. Lake Como I must utter though, seems an odd choice. Interesting, but "adrenaline junkies" on a river cruise?! For small town charm I might offer other places as a river cruise company. Would I do a four hour drive to get to a post-cruise destination crossing the whole of Switzerland? I do not know. But then river cruise port Nuremberg to Prague is not dissimilar in being a "distant" post-cruise stay. Of the two, Lake Comco and Prague I regard the latter, though, as much more appealing. Why not have Trier as a pre- or post-cruise stay, great for getting to Luxembourg, and even some regions of France, Reims with its real Champagne?
